

About Scott
Originally from Cleveland, Scott attended The Ohio State University, where he studied psychology—an expertise he now applies to every negotiation. His ability to understand people, timing, and deal dynamics gives his clients a distinct advantage, resulting in smarter positioning, stronger leverage, and better outcomes.
Calm under pressure and highly intentional in his approach, Scott is trusted for his ability to navigate complex transactions with clarity and precision. Whether creating demand, controlling the narrative, or closing with confidence, every move is designed to protect his clients’ goals.
Scott’s business is built on relationships, not transactions. He offers a curated, hands-on experience rooted in constant communication, strategic insight, and tailored guidance from the first showing to the final signature.
A longtime Los Angeles resident, Scott brings an instinctive understanding of the city—from Santa Monica to the Valley and everywhere in between. Outside of real estate, he finds inspiration in global travel, architecture, and art.
